No I wasn’t. I wasn’t surprised or shocked. Warriors had a solid game plan. They knew if Green scores and made plays for others Rockets win. So they singled up on Sengun, trapped and blitzed Green, played zone and took their chances with Rockets 3 pt shooting. I was frustrated when he had some lanes and wasn’t aggressive or shot poorly when open but for most of the series he simply had nowhere to go. We have seen our offense crumble against zone and traps on Jalen. I was more disappointed in other guys like Tari, Amen, and Brooks who didn’t play well in several games when they had the opportunity to shine. I expected more from Amen really and he did have 2 maybe 3 good games but didn’t play to his potential in several especially that game 1.
